Detailed Description

Guoli Chemical's Dodecanol/Lauryl Alcohol 12 Alcohol L-23 (CAS: 68439-50-9) is a mixture of straight-chain saturated primary alcohols with C12 as the main component and a small amount of C14. At room temperature, it appears as a colorless liquid or white waxy solid (melting point 23~25°C). As a long-chain fatty alcohol, its molecular structure possesses both a hydrophobic long carbon chain and a reactive hydroxyl group, naturally endowing it with excellent emulsifying, wetting, and dispersing capabilities. It serves as the core hydrophobic group source for synthesizing various anionic and nonionic surfactants.

In terms of chemical reactivity, L-23 exhibits all the typical chemical properties of primary alcohols and can smoothly participate in various derivatization reactions such as ethoxylation, sulfation, and esterification, offering flexible synthesis pathways that conveniently convert it into high value-added products like sodium dodecyl sulfate (SLS), lauryl alcohol polyoxyethylene ether (AEO series), and s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ES). Meanwhile, its high purity (≥99% active content) and narrow carbon chain distribution ensure high batch-to-batch consistency in downstream formulations.

With its balanced hydrophilic-lipophilic properties (HLB value approx. 1.3), L-23 can be used directly as a co-emulsifier and thickener in cream and lotion formulations, or as a precursor for emollient esters in personal care products. Its low degree of unsaturation (iodine value ≤1) and good chemical stability allow it to maintain excellent quality even under high temperature or long-term storage conditions.

Application Recommendations

Based on L-23's high purity and excellent reactivity, its main application directions include:

  • Surfactant Synthesis: As a core raw material for producing sodium dodecyl sulfate (SLS), s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ES), and f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ether (AEO series), serving shampoo, shower gel, toothpaste, and industrial cleaning formulations.
  • Personal Care Products: Used directly as a co-emulsifier and thickener in creams and lotions, or as a synthesis precursor for emollient esters (such as dodecyl lactate), providing a delicate skin feel.
  • Industrial Auxiliaries: As a raw material for smoothing and softening agents in textile finishing, as a component of fatliquoring agents in leather processing, and as an intermediate in lubricants and plastic plasticizers.
  • Organic Synthesis Intermediates: Used to prepare fragrances (dodecanal, dodecanoates) or pharmaceutical carrier materials through oxidation, esterification, and other reactions.

Precautions

  • Safety Protection: The product is classified as Skin/Eye Irritation Category 2 (GHS07 Warning). Protective gloves, goggles, and protective clothing must be worn during operation. Thoroughly wash skin after handling.
  • Environmental Risk: Highly toxic to aquatic life with long-lasting effects (GHS09). Do not discharge the product or wastewater containing it into natural water bodies. Waste disposal must be handled by qualified units through high-temperature incineration.
  • Storage Requirements: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ated warehouse. Recommended temperature below 40°C (since its melting point is about 23~25°C, solidification at low temperature is normal). Keep away from strong oxidizers and ignition sources. Keep container tightly closed.
  • Operating Environment: Ensure good ventilation in the operation area. Use explosion-proof electrical equipment. Prevent electrostatic accumulation. Do not eat or smoke during operation.
